  • Beautiful Boy

    Beautiful Boy

    ★★½

    I appreciate how this movie is constructed around the perspective of the family of an addict, but the film also feels lacking in urgency and impact because there isn’t enough of the son's perspective to ground the story properly. It doesn’t have to be much more, but a little more time spent with the son would help shore up many of this movie’s problems.

  • Claudine

    Claudine

    ★★

    I understand and can appreciate what this movie is trying to do with the romanatic comedy trappings used to explore the lived experience of a black mother but the styles don't mesh as well as the filmmakers probably hoped they would. Diahann Carroll and James Earl Jones hold this movie together to prevent it from falling apart, but, because the central concept of the movie doesn't fully work, the film is never quite compelling or funny enough to be a smashing success.
